The City of San Diego uses more green power than any other local government in the country. The ranking is based on the Environmental Protection Agency's Green Power list of businesses and governments that use power from renewable energy sources. San Diego Mayor Jerry Sanders says the Point Loma Wastewater Treatment Plant is a good example of the city's efforts.

Sanders: This plant has become self-sufficient for its energy needs because we have found ways to capture biogas, a natural by-product of the sewage treatment process, and to use it to generate electricity.

Sanders says using green power to run the city's treatment and reclamation plants saves more than $5.4 million a year.
